behind |
in or at the back of; on the other side of. |
energy |
the ability to have force or power or to do work. There are many kinds of energy such as physical, electrical, nuclear, or chemical. |
floor |
the lowest surface in a room; the surface on which one stands in a room. |
mess |
a state of being dirty or not neat. |
movie |
a motion picture; film. |
mysterious |
not known and not able to be explained. |
nap1 |
to sleep for a short time during daylight hours. |
nervous |
feeling worry or fear about a particular thing or things. |
party |
a group of people coming together to celebrate or have fun. |
patrol |
the act of guarding by making regular trips through. |
pulse |
the regular beating of the arteries that is caused by the beating of the heart. The pulse can be felt in the wrist or neck. |
rod |
a straight, thin stick or bar. |
splendid |
beautiful or grand; making a strong impression. |
stranger |
a person that you do not know. |
taste |
to tell the flavor of something by putting it into your mouth. |
